一、前期准备与策划阶段
二、技术选型与环境搭建 4. 选择开发框架:如微信小程序、支付宝小程序、百度智能小程序等,依据目标平台选择对应的开发框架。 5. 安装开发工具:下载并安装官方提供的开发工具,如微信开发者工具等。 6. 创建项目:新建小程序项目,配置基本信息,如appid、项目名称等。
三、设计与前端开发 7. 视觉设计:设计师根据原型图完成详细的UI设计,确定色彩、字体、图标等视觉元素。 8. 前端编码:
四、后端服务开发与接口联调 9. 后端服务器搭建:如果小程序需要后台支持,则需要搭建数据库、部署服务器,并开发后端API接口。 10. 前后端对接:前端调用后端接口获取或发送数据,进行接口联调测试,确保数据传输正确无误。
五、功能测试与优化 11. 单元测试:对各个功能模块进行单独测试,确保单个功能点稳定可用。 12. 集成测试:在真实环境下全面验证整个小程序的完整流程,检查是否存在兼容性、性能等问题。 13. 性能优化:对加载速度、内存占用、耗电量等方面进行优化,提升用户体验。
六、审核发布 14. 提交审核:按照各平台要求整理相关资料,提交小程序进行审核,确保遵守平台规定。 15. 上线部署:通过审核后,将小程序发布至对应平台,供用户搜索和使用。
七、后期运维与迭代 16. 数据分析:借助平台提供的数据分析工具,监控小程序运行状况,收集用户行为数据。 17. 用户反馈与优化:根据用户反馈及时修复问题,优化功能,不断迭代更新小程序版本。
重点内容:
总结来说,小程序开发涉及从需求梳理、设计构思、前后端开发、测试优化直至上线发布的全过程,每个环节都需要精细操作与严谨把控,以确保最终产出的小程序既满足功能需求,又能提供优质的用户体验。同时,在开发过程中要密切关注平台动态,适应政策和技术的变化,保持小程序与时俱进。